我目前正在Flutter应用中创建更新图像过程。
我已经成功地使用Network Image
获取了从 View.dart 中定义的某些小部件传递到 Update_screen.dart 中定义的UpdateScreen小部件的图像。>
CircleAvatar(
radius: 100,
backgroundImage: NetworkImage(
'${Urls.BASE_API_IMAGE}/${widget.imageUpdate}'),
),
我的问题是,如何使用Image.file()
设置默认图像? ,因为我必须使用Image.file()
来更新数据。
谢谢
答案 0 :(得分:0)
您可以使用此软件包cached_network_image,因为它可以轻松设置默认图像。
示例
CachedNetworkImage(
imageUrl: "your url",
placeholder: (context, url) =>Your default Image Widget(),
errorWidget: (context, url, error) => new Icon(Icons.error),
),